.NET数据库连接语句实现流程
为了实现.NET数据库连接语句,我们需要遵循以下步骤:
步骤 | 描述 |
---|---|
第一步 | 引用数据库连接相关的命名空间 |
第二步 | 创建数据库连接对象 |
第三步 | 设置数据库连接字符串 |
第四步 | 打开数据库连接 |
第五步 | 执行数据库操作 |
第六步 | 关闭数据库连接 |
第一步:引用命名空间
在使用.NET数据库连接语句之前,我们需要引用相关的命名空间。常用的命名空间包括System.Data
和System.Data.SqlClient
。其中,System.Data
命名空间包含了一些用于操作数据库的基本类型和接口,而System.Data.SqlClient
命名空间则提供了与Microsoft SQL Server数据库的连接和操作功能。
在代码中,可以通过以下方式引用这些命名空间:
using System.Data;
using System.Data.SqlClient;
第二步:创建数据库连接对象
在使用.NET连接数据库之前,我们需要创建一个数据库连接对象。可以使用SqlConnection
类来创建一个与SQL Server数据库的连接对象。
SqlConnection connection = new SqlConnection();
第三步:设置数据库连接字符串
在创建数据库连接对象后,我们需要设置数据库连接字符串。数据库连接字符串包含了连接所需的信息,如数据库服务器的名称、登录名和密码等。可以通过ConnectionString
属性来设置连接字符串。
connection.ConnectionString = "Data Source=serverName;Initial Catalog=databaseName;User ID=userName;Password=password";
其中,serverName
是数据库服务器的名称,databaseName
是要连接的数据库名称,userName
和password
是登录数据库所需的用户名和密码。
第四步:打开数据库连接
在设置数据库连接字符串后,我们可以使用Open
方法打开数据库连接。
connection.Open();
第五步:执行数据库操作
在成功打开数据库连接后,我们可以执行各种数据库操作,如查询、插入、更新等。这里以查询数据库为例,展示如何执行一个SELECT语句。
string query = "SELECT * FROM tableName";
SqlCommand command = new SqlCommand(query, connection);
// 执行查询并返回结果集
SqlDataReader reader = command.ExecuteReader();
// 循环读取结果集中的数据
while (reader.Read())
{
// 处理数据
}
// 关闭结果集和数据库连接
reader.Close();
其中,tableName
是要查询的表名。通过SqlCommand
类创建一个SQL命令对象,将查询语句和数据库连接对象传递给它。然后,使用ExecuteReader
方法执行查询并返回一个SqlDataReader
对象。通过循环调用Read
方法,可以逐行读取结果集中的数据。
第六步:关闭数据库连接
在完成数据库操作后,我们需要关闭数据库连接,以释放资源。
connection.Close();
以上就是.NET数据库连接语句的实现流程。通过引用命名空间、创建连接对象、设置连接字符串、打开连接、执行数据库操作和关闭连接,我们可以很方便地连接和操作数据库。
请注意,以上只是一个简单的示例,实际应用中可能还需要处理异常、事务等情况。此外,连接字符串中的参数也会因不同的数据库类型和配置而有所不同。
序列图
下面是一个使用Mermaid语法标识出的序列图,展示了整个实现流程的交互过程。
sequenceDiagram
participant 开发者 as Dev
participant 小白 as Junior
participant 数据库 as DB
小白->>开发者: 请求教学
activate 开发者
开发者-->>小白: 回应请求
deactivate 开发者
小白->>开发者: 学习.NET数据库连接语句
activate 开发者
开发者-->>小白: 解释整体流程
开发者-->>小白: 引用命名空间
开发者-->>小白: 创建连接对象
开发者-->>小白: 设置连接字符串
开发者-->>小白: 打开连接
开发者-->>小白: 执行数据库操作
开发者-->>小白: 关闭连接
开发者-->>